Output 30aa88571844eaf83564f609c411861dcb5fe79062c51ae534ef93d3e2aebe0f:1

value
184870766
script pubkey
OP_0 OP_PUSHBYTES_20 35090221cf257e9cf4508da16f52bd86a62e5129
address
ltc1qx5ysygw0y4lfeazs3ksk754as6nzu5ffxy38ex
transaction
30aa88571844eaf83564f609c411861dcb5fe79062c51ae534ef93d3e2aebe0f
spent
true